Input DatetimeLocal defaultValue Atributo

Definição e uso

defaultValue Define ou retorna o valor padrão do campo de data e hora local.

Nota:O valor padrão é Atributo value do HTML de acordo com o especificado.

A diferença entre os atributos defaultValue e value está em:

  • defaultValue contém o valor padrão
  • enquanto value contém o valor atual após algumas alterações
  • Se não houver mudanças, defaultValue e value são iguais (veja o exemplo abaixo)

Se você quiser verificar se o campo de data e hora local foi alterado, o atributo defaultValue é muito útil.

Exemplo

Exemplo 1

Alterar o valor padrão do campo de data e hora local:

document.getElementById("myLocalDate").defaultValue = "2015-01-02T11:42:13.510";

Experimente você mesmo

Exemplo 2

Obter o valor padrão do campo de data e hora local:

var x = document.getElementById("myLocalDate").defaultValue;

Experimente você mesmo

Exemplo 3

Um exemplo que mostra a diferença entre os atributos defaultValue e value:

var x = document.getElementById("myLocalDate");
var defaultVal = x.defaultValue;
var currentVal = x.value;

Experimente você mesmo

Sintaxe

Retornar o atributo defaultValue:

datetimelocalObject.defaultValue

Definir o atributo defaultValue:

datetimelocalObject.defaultValue = value

Valor do atributo

Valor Descrição
value Define o valor padrão do campo de data e hora local.

Detalhes técnicos

Retorno: Valor de string que representa o valor padrão do campo de data e hora local.

Suporte do navegador

Os números na tabela indicam a versão do navegador que suporta plenamente essa propriedade.

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
Suporte 10.0 Suporte Suporte Suporte

Atenção:O elemento <input type="datetime-local"> não exibe nenhum campo de data e hora nem calendário no Firefox.